Publication number: 20230170368Abstract: An image sensor includes a plurality of liquid-lens units, which include: a lower electrode and an upper electrode; a dielectric layer disposed between the lower electrode and the upper electrode; a containment space disposed between the dielectric layer and the upper electrode; and a non-polar liquid and a polar liquid filled into the containment space, wherein the non-polar liquid and the polar liquid are immiscible with each other. The non-polar liquid is configured to occupy a first contact area on the dielectric layer under a first voltage, and a second contact area on the dielectric layer under a second voltage. The first contact area is larger than the second contact area, and the second voltage is higher than the first voltage.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 30, 2021Publication date: June 1, 2023Inventors: Wei-Lung TSAI, Huang-Jen CHEN, Ching-Chiang WU, Yu-Chi CHANG

Patent number: 9837637Abstract: An electroluminescent (EL) device is disclosed, comprising a first electrode, a second electrode, one or more functional layers, and a conducting layer. The first electrode is transparent and with a high refractive index nH more than 1.75. The one or more functional layers include a light emitting layer. The conducting layer has a low refractive index nL less than 1.65, being disposed between the first electrode and the one or more functional layers. By judicious combination of the first electrode and conducting layer to induce appropriate microcavity effects, increased coupling efficiencies of EL device could be then obtained.Type: GrantFiled: October 15, 2015Date of Patent: December 5, 2017Assignee: NATIONAL TAIWAN UNIVERSITYInventors: Chung-Chih Wu, Yi-Hsiang Huang, Wei-Lung Tsai, Min Jiao, Wei-Kai Lee
